Sacramento mayor Kevin Johnson and Kings co-owners Joe and Gavin Maloof gathered some of the region's most influential businessmen Tuesday with a shared mission in mind: sell out the Kings' first two home games.
I'll have more detail on this venture in tomorrow's paper, but it's essentially a push to sell tickets at the big boy level and have more concentrated efforts to sell individual tickets sprouting from there. The campaign committee on hand included Mike Daugherty, John Frisch, Matt Haines, Lloyd Harvego, Gerry Kamilos, Sotiris Kolokotronis, Hayden Markstein, Arlen Opper, Randy Paragary, Chevo Ramirez, Tim Ray, Bruce Scheidt, Tim Stenvick and Allen Warren.

Mayor and Kings collaborate Sacramento Mayor Kevin Johnson and a "prestigious group of Sacramento business leaders" will announce today at Arco Arena a plan to sell out the first two Kings home games this season.
Kings co-owners Joe and Gavin Maloof, Kings president of basketball operations Geoff Petrie, Westphal and members of the business group will be at the news conference.
Attendance continued to decline at Arco last season as losses piled up. The Kings had only three sellouts last season.
